  14. good morning all, hope everybody is safe and well. I've posted another thread on here regarding overpower cards, but thats run off in a tangent (mainly because of my stupid questions) so thought I'd start a new one as I'm in desperate need of assistance. The current set up I have got are as follows:- Various 70mm eley, rose gold and RC HPF3 hulls. Lee Load All 2 Alliant Herco powder CCI 209 primers 18mm fibre wads No 7 shot The main issues I'm finding is that I didn't realise the Load All wasn't designed for fibre wads, but various members have told me they have loaded them fine, and I would like to continue this from an environmental point. I'm also aware I need overpowder cards or wads so I'll be getting those. My thought train so far is that I've used the data from the Alliant manual for 2 3/4 inch Fiocchi hulls, and the grain range dependant on wad (as fibre isn't listed) is between 25.5 and 26. I've test loaded (with used primer) an Ely Hull, loaded the powder, inserted the wad, loaded the 32g of no7 shot and have a gap of 9.6mm between the top of the shot and the crease line in the cartridge, or 18.2mm total distance between the top of the shot and the opening edge of the cartridge. My questions are, are the grain assumptions ok as ive gone with the .180 insert in the Load All which should give a projected 26.3 grain, but after several weighing checks is coming out at 24.7 grains. And do I have to make the 9.6mm gap up with overpowder cards/wads as this seems a large gap to me? Apologies in advance for all the questions but I'm a total newbie at reloading and have scoured the net and manuals etc, but just feel a bit more confident with your expert assistance Many thanks!
